Output 3184dfa8cab2f414d4a7c6b867c105b660ef962f301bab5007a7ff6668085a7a:1

value
3426470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e9ad17d990b7180423d9f34d302ed34cbf4f17d OP_EQUAL
address
38re6ULdyWgVUqa5MnMZMZJwdZJCJQgmEB
transaction
3184dfa8cab2f414d4a7c6b867c105b660ef962f301bab5007a7ff6668085a7a
spent
true